[0032] figure 1 An apparatus 1 for calibrating a multi-channel liquid handling device such as a pipette is shown. In general, the apparatus comprises a liquid handling module 10 and a weighing device 11 . The liquid handling module 10 is provided with an outer cover 74 and a top cover 76, both of which enclose other working components. The top cover 76 is provided with an opening 78 and its access is controlled by a shutter 80 . like figure 1 As shown, the shutter 80 is configured to slide back and forth to block access to the opening 78 in one location and provide access to the opening 78 in another location. The operator can access the container 26 through the opening 78 ( figure 1 not shown). Below the top cover 76 are means for arranging and maintaining a water-filled evaporation well (not shown) for receiving water from the container 26 ( figure 1 Evaporation loss not shown). Abstract

A sample processing module and apparatus for calibrating a multi-channel liquid processing device are disclosed. The sample processing module co-operates with a weighing balance and includes a holding device having holders arranged sequentially and equally spaced apart from each other and configured to receive containers. The sample processing module further comprises a support device comprising an array of prongs that provide lateral support to the holder when the holder is detached from the load receiver; and an actuation device operatively connected to the holder through the array of prongs. The actuation means can be operated to mount the holder to the load receiver one at a time by disengaging the respective prongs supporting the holder. A system and method of operating an actuation device are also disclosed. The sample processing module of the present invention is modular and compact, enabling easy manufacturing, handling, repair and servicing.

technical field [0001] The present invention relates to the calibration of multi-channel liquid handling devices such as pipettes, and more particularly to a sample processing module for gravimetric calibration of multi-channel liquid handling devices in cooperation with a weighing device. Background technique [0002] A pipette is a liquid handling instrument used in a laboratory to transfer a predetermined volume of a test liquid. Several analytical procedures in a laboratory setting involve the use of pipettes to dispense liquids. Multichannel pipettes are efficient laboratory tools because they allow simultaneous aspiration of liquid from one or more containers and immediate dispensing into several target containers. When using a multi-channel pipette, the amount of liquid aspirated and dispensed should be the same in all channels.
